What Is HOA Law?
A homeowners’ association (HOA) is essentially a hyperlocal government that oversees a condominium building or a subdivision of homes. The elected board members can enforce the HOA’s property codes, perform maintenance, and issue fines for noise or parking violations. While many people appreciate that HOA neighborhoods feature well-maintained properties, HOA boards can also be the source of endless annoyance and disputes.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need an HOA Lawyer?
You should consult with an HOA lawyer to get more information about your rights if you are being fined by your HOA for:
- Excessive noise
- Not following parking rules
- Improper yard maintenance
- Displaying a flag
- Not paying your HOA dues
How Can a Lawyer Help Me With an HOA Dispute?
While HOAs can enforce their own rules, those rules cannot violate federal, Florida, or laws. A lawyer can determine if your HOA board is acting within the bounds of the law when enforcing violations against you. They can speak with board members on your behalf and work to find a resolution that protects your rights.

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Real Estate Lawyer in Stuart?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case. Many real estate lawyers offer an initial consultation that allows you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- What is your experience in handling real estate cases in Florida?
- Have you represented property owners in cases like mine?
- What are potential issues that can come up during the property purchase?
- How will you keep me informed about updates in my case?
- What is the likely timeline for resolving my case?
- What is your fee structure for legal representation?
